Job Introduction

Vacherin are committed to delivering deliciously different experiences, having fun, and conducting business with a social and environmental conscience. We are excited to be recruiting for a Hospitality Manager to work at Womble Bond Dickinson - London.

Location: Womble Bond Dickinson, London

Salary: £45,000 per annum + performance related bonus

Shift Pattern: Monday-Friday, 40 hours per week, flexible working hours

Key Responsibilities:

  1. Supervise and lead the butler and two Front of House team members, ensuring smooth daily operations and delivering high-quality service.
  2. Work closely with the chef to ensure that all food offerings, from sandwich lunches to fine dining, are of the highest standard and meet client expectations.
  3. Oversee the planning and execution of all events and hospitality services, ensuring they are delivered seamlessly and to the client's satisfaction.
  4. Supervise the preparation and service of sandwich lunches (up to 100 covers) and fine dining (up to 15 covers) per day, maintaining high standards of food quality and presentation.
  5. Manage the operations of three conference rooms, ensuring they are set up appropriately for each event and that all client needs are met during their meetings.

Previous experience within B&I is desirable.
